SENIOR HYDROGRAPHIC SURVEYOR / PARTY CHIEF

Due to the continued expansion of our portfolio of survey services we have an exciting opportunity for an experienced Senior Hydrographic Surveyor / Party Chief  to join our team and to support operational and QA processes.

The successful candidate will assist the management team with the running of the Hydrographic Survey Department, with  responsibility for the management of delegated projects to meet agreed timescales and client expectations and involvement in the supervision, training and development of staff within the hydrographic survey team.

Main Duties & Responsibilities:

  • Support the management team in the efficient running of the department.
  • Act as Party Chief on specific projects.
  • Maintain effective lines of communication with management, colleagues and clients.
  • Have the ability to make decisions and possess a can-do attitude.
  • Provide technical knowledge to the commercial team to assist with tendering and enquiries.
  • Participate in the supervision and training of Hydrographic Surveyors / Graduate Hydrographic Surveyors.
  • Undertake hydrographic surveys including client liaison, on site data collection, post processing, analysis, presentation, charting and reporting of survey data, acting as Project Lead when required.
  • Co-ordinate and progress survey activities in accordance with Scope of Work, Technical Specifications and relevant procedures to ensure compliance with QA processes.
  • Assist with vessel and survey equipment mobilisation / maintenance to ensure that calibration, certification and servicing routines are completed in accordance with manufacturer and industry standards.
  • Maintain and take responsibility for a healthy and safe working environment and work in accordance with company policy and statutory requirements at all times, ensuring compliance by junior staff.

Essential Criteria:

Candidates should have a degree in a survey/marine related discipline and / or professional accreditation (e.g. IHO Cat A, RICS, MCInstCES or MIMarEST etc.) and demonstrable relevant industry experience at senior level.

  • Experience in QPS QiNSY, Qimera, Fledermaus, Hypack, EIVA NaviSuite, and Chesapeake SonarWiz acquisition & processing software packages.
  • Acquisition and processing of Multibeam & Singlebeam Bathymetry and data from Side-scan Sonar, Magnetometer, Geophysical & LiDAR Sensors.
  • CAD & GIS skills are essential
  • Demonstrable relevant industry experience at senior level.
  • Effective decision-making skills and a positive ‘can-do’ attitude.
  • Boat handling experience, RYA / MCA Commercial endorsement advantageous.
  • Driving License and ability to tow trailers up to 3,500kg.
  • Ability to spend periods of time away from home is essential.

LAND SURVEYORS

Due to our expanding portfolio of survey services we have an exciting opportunity for experienced Land Surveyors to join our team.

The role will involve working within an experienced survey team, on a variety of sites throughout the UK and occasionally further field, utilising RTK GNSS, Total Stations & Laser Scanning equipment. Due to the nature of the work, a flexible approach to working hours is essential, as is a willingness to stay away when necessary.

Duties will include:

  • Topographic Surveys
  • River Sections & Bathymetric Surveys
  • Measured Building Surveys
  • Static & Mobile Laser Scanning
  • 3D Photogrammetry
  • Working with UAVs
  • 3D Modelling & BIM
  • GNSS PPK Post-processing
  • Processing Survey data and issuing drawings/reports
  • Liaising with Clients
  • Identifying and mitigating potential QHSE risks
  • Managing delegated projects to meet agreed requirements

Essential Criteria

  • Survey related qualification to Degree / HND level.
  • Demonstrable surveying / data processing experience across a range of survey disciplines
  • Proficiency in AutoCad and survey processing software such as Trimble TBC, PosPac & LSS
  • Good problem solving, self-management and interpersonal skills
  • Ability to work independently to tight deadlines
  • Full UK Driving License
